S4 class methods plotting sample MCF from data, estimated MCF, or
esttimated baseline rate function from a fitted model by using
ggplot2
plotting system. The plots generated are thus able to be
further customized properly.

A logical value indicating
whether to plot confidence interval.
The default value is FALSE
.
A logical value with default FALSE
.
If TRUE
, each censoring time is marked by "+" on the MCF curves.
Otherwise, the censoring time would not be marked.
An optional numeric vector indicating line types specified to different groups: 0 = blank, 1 = solid, 2 = dashed, 3 = dotted, 4 = dotdash, 5 = longdash, 6 = twodash.
An optional character vector indicating line colors specified to different groups.
